Q: Is 6,686,058 a Prime Number?
A: No, 6,686,058 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 6686058 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 227 454 681 1,362 4,909 9,818 14,727 29,454 1,114,343 2,228,686 3,343,029 and 6,686,058, with no remainder.
Since 6,686,058 cannot be divided by just 1 and 6,686,058, it is not a prime number.
